The Western Australian Soccer Football Association (WASFA) was football's peak organising body in Western Australia from 1896 (the first year of organised soccer in WA) to 1959. The Soccer Federation of Western Australia (SFWA) took over this role in 1960 when the top eight WA clubs broke away from the WASFA to form their new semi-professional league under the new SFWA banner. The WASFA continued their leagues in direct competition with the SFWA, however this only continued till 1962 with the demise of their association.
YEAR CUP WINNERS 1898 Civil Service 1899 Fremantle Wanderers 1900 Civil Service 1901 Fremantle Wanderers 1902 Civil Service 1903 Civil Services 1904 Perth 1905 Corinthians 1906 Rangers 1907 Fremantle Rovers 1908 Rangers 1909 City United 1910 Claremont 1911 Fremantle 1912 Claremont 1913 Claremont 1914 Thistle 1915 Claremont 1916 Competition Suspended due to WW1 1917 Competition Suspended due to WW1 1918 Competition Suspended due to WW1 1919 Thistle 1920 Claremont 1921 Casuals 1922 Thistle 1923 Claremont 1924 Northern Casuals 1925 Northern Casuals 1926 Northern Casuals 1927 Caledonian 1928 Casuals 1929 Victoria Park 1930 Thistle 1931 Victoria Park 1932 Northern Casuals 1933 Victoria Park 1934 Victoria Park 1935 Caledonian 1936 Victoria Park/Caledonian 1937 Victoria Park/Caledonian 1938 Victoria Park 1939 Caledonian 1940 Victoria Park 1941 Spearwood 1942 Competition Suspended due to WW2 1943 Competition Suspended due to WW2 1944 Competition Suspended due to WW2 1945 Competition Suspended due to WW2 1946 Maccabeans 1947 North Perth 1948 South Perth 1949 Caledonian 1950 Perth City 1951 South Perth 1952 North Perth 1953 Azzurri 1954 Swan Athletic 1955 Perth City 1956 Swan Valley 1957 Perth City 1958 Azzurri 1959 Windmills
